I don't know any easy way to do this other than to "follow" me.

Only other way is to get into a specific car then search for my name. Its a bit of a pain. Still not quite as easy as the F4 storefront. But at least a huge leap forward from F5 / FH2.
I also found out if you are in the mp lobby or leagues, you can click that persons name and directly download their paint jobs or tunes while in the lobby if the race is over. That's a nice feature. You might also be able to follow them from that menu but I am not sure.

Can you take the hood off? Some cars wont allow you to "open" the hood but if you approach the engine area it will allow you to remove any cover on the engine. Same with some of the race for instance the BMW#25. Also the McLaren P1 you can remove the entire engine cover. If you ever hit the "explode" option and the hood doesn't open, always approach the hood or engine compartment and try my suggestion. Even the Subaru Brat lets you sit in the back of the bed where the seats are at.

EDIT: Oh also keep in mind. If you upgrade the engine at all with certain parts or even swap the engine, you will no longer be able to view the engine. So if you do ever want to check a car out, do it before you start swapping engines or engine parts.
